Risk Analytics – Analyst/ Associate, Firm Risk Management
We’re seeking someone to join our team as a Analyst/ Associate to IMM Counterparty Credit Risk, Risk Analytics team
Job Responsibilities:
• Research, development, enhancement, and documentation of IMM Counterparty credit risk, methodologies, and tools for regulatory and risk management purposes
• Perform analysis including model recalibrations, back-tests, stress tests, scenario, and sensitivity analyses.
• Programming of prototypes/production code (within an established C++/R /Python libraries) which will be productionized.
• Program, test and implement quantitative financial methods using Python, C++, VBA, R, Matlab and SQL
• Utilize advanced statistics, econometrics and mathematical skills including probability theory, stochastic calculus, Monte Carlo simulation, numerical analysis, optimization techniques and time series analysis
• Work with Technology on model testing, implementation, and production
• Collaborate with risk managers and other stakeholders to address their requests and for relevant model enhancements
• Participate in Regulatory and validation exams by providing documentation and responses to regulators and internal validators
Qualification:
• 0-2 (Analyst), 2.5+ (Associate) and 6+ (Director) years of work experience in quantitative modeling, Risk Management, algorithmic trading
• Analytical skills and ability to work with diverse cultures in a global team.
• Strong knowledge of financial traded products e.g. derivatives and their pricing.
• Knowledge and hands-on experience in one of the programming languages R, Python, MATLAB, C# or C++ is strongly preferred.
• Excellent communication skills (Oral and written). Ability to communicate and present logically, precisely and in simple manner, complex and technical issues.
Required Qualifications
• Graduate/Under-graduate/Advance degrees in finance, mathematics, physics econometrics, engineering or other quantitative subjects.
• Candidates should have a strong theoretical foundation in mathematics, quantitative finance and derivatives.
• Candidates will have to deal in Python, SQL queries, and MS-Office on daily basis.
